269  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Re: Why bitcoin is not supported in some countries? on: April 13, 2018, 05:31:41 AM
Crypto currency is a very revolutionary new kind of financial settlements, which is perceived by many states if not hostile, then with disbelief. For the state, crypto currency is very inconvenient in the sense that it can not be controlled. It is capable, without any accounting and control, of withdrawing any funds from the territory of any state, and this is highly displeasing to the states. In addition, any profit from financial transactions in any state is subject to taxation, and transactions in the use of crypto currency are very difficult to take into account and tax. Even these two moments are for any government a very big obstacle in the use of crypto currency.
Well, that is because bitcoin is a decentralized system, so no other person can control over it and its just between you and your peers. Therefore that is one of the reason why government doesn't adopt bitcoin because they can't gain control on bitcoin and in the first place they think bitcoin is prone to criminality because its transaction is always been anonymous.
